ISO 683-2 Grade 39MnB5
ISO 683-2 Grade 39MnB5 introduction
Quenchable boron steel represent a breakthrough in heat treatment technology. This steel uses boron as a hardening agent. The melting and refining process, together with thermomechanical treatment by controlled hot rolling, allow ArcelorMittal quenchable boron steel to attain a remarkable degree of hardness and a very uniform microstructure, resulting in excellent mechanical loading performance after heat treatment of the finished part.
Equivalent material: EN 38MnB5
ISO 683-2 Grade 39MnB5 chemical
Property | Value | Comment |
---|---|---|
Boron | Boron of 0.0008 - 0.005 % | - |
Carbon | Carbon of 0.36 - 0.42 % | - |
Manganese | Manganese of 1.15 - 1.45 % | - |
Phosphorus | Phosphorus of 0.025 % | max. |
Silicon | Silicon of 0.4 % | max. |
Sulfur | Sulfur of 0.035 % | max. |
